如何利用菌株的基因信息构建基因组数据库?

如何利用菌株的基因信息构建基因组数据库?

步骤:

  1. 收集菌株的基因信息:

    • 从 GenBank 或其他基因数据库中检索菌株的基因序列。
    • 也可以从其他来源收集,例如细菌数据库或真核生物数据库。
  2. 清洗和格式化基因信息:

    • 移除重复的序列。
    • 标准化序列长度。
    • 编码序列为氨基酸序列。
  3. 构建基因组数据库:

    • 使用数据库管理系统 (DBMS) 建立数据库。
    • 存储基因序列、注释和其他相关信息。
    • 创建索引,以提高查询效率。
  4. 添加注释:

    • 添加注释,以解释基因的功能和功能。
    • 可以使用注释工具,例如 GeneMark 或 BLAST。
  5. 验证和维护数据库:

    • 确保数据库的准确性和完整性。
    • 定期更新基因信息。
    • 监控数据库的性能。

工具和资源:

  • **GenBank:**用于存储细菌和真核生物基因序列。
  • **NCBI:**提供生物信息中心 (NCBI) 的资源,包括 GenBank 和 BLAST。
  • **Biopython:**用于处理生物数据的高级编程包。
  • **MySQL:**用于构建基因组数据库的数据库管理系统。

注意:

  • 确保使用合规的许可协议获取基因信息。
  • 确保数据库的安全性,以防止未经授权的访问。
  • 考虑使用数据库管理系统,例如 MySQL 或 PostgreSQL,以管理大规模基因组数据库。
相似内容
更多>